quote:

The Brits win rock post 1980 as well. America doesn't have a band to compete with

The Smiths
The Stone Roses
Radiohead


The Stone Roses had one great album. It's admittedly fantastic, but geez, so did Clap Your Hands and Say Yeah! Hell, I'll put Washington DC by itself up against that list.

One album wonder? Minor Threat or Rites of Spring.
Band that defined a subgenre? I give you Black Flag (ok, they are primarily west coast, but Rollins is DC) and Bad Brains. (or on an even smaller scale, Nation of Ulysses)
Revered alt band that is known for its unique distribution to attack the record industry? Fugazi says hi.

That's not even getting into Chuck Brown, who misses my 1980 cutoff point. But DC has its own genre in go-go (we also invented emo... they can't all be winners).
